Недетерминированные автоматы в проектировании систем параллельной обработки. Вашкевич Н.П. - 136 стр.

UptoLike

Составители: 

136
x
1
x
L
Ксх1
S
0
(t)
S
j
(t)
S
m
(t)
S
0
(t+1)
Q
0
S
j
(t+1)
Q
j
S
m
(t+1)
Q
m
Ксх2
РЧС
y
1
y
k
y
N
Ксх3
y
1
y
k
y
N
x
1
x
L
Рис. 5.8. Структурная схема одноуровневой системы МПУ,
представленная на основе использования НД СКУ
в виде совмещенного C-автомата
На рис. 5.8 представлены следующие блоки системы МПУ:
Ксх1 - многовыходная комбинационная схема реализует функции переходов
в системе МПУ (последовательность выполнения микрокоманд):
mjSSSxxxftS
mLj
Y
j
j
,0),,...,,,,...,,()1(
1021
(5.12)
Ксх2 - многовыходная комбинационная схема реализует функции выходов
модели автомата Мура:
))((
;,1),()(
V
kjj
Y
jk
yYS
NktSty
j
(5.13)
Ксх3 - многовыходная комбинационная схема реализует функции выходов
модели автомата Мили:
NktSty
j
Y
jk
,1),1()(
V
(5.14)
где [x
1
, x
2
,…, x
L
] - элементарные входные сигналы (осведомительные сигналы
от операционного автомата (ОА) );
[y
1
,…, y
k
,…, y
N
] - элементарные выходные сигналы, инициирующие
выполнение микроопераций в ОА;
[S
0
, S
1
,…, S
m
] - частные события, реализуемые в алгоритме управления;
Y
j
- совокупность управляющих сигналов, отмечающих событие S
j
;
РЧС - регистр частных событий, организованный на двухступенчатых Д-
триггерах; для унитарного кодирования событий каждому событию S
j
      x1                          S0(t+1)
                      Ксх1                           Q0                      Ксх2       y1



             …




                                                                     …




                                                                                    …
      xL
                                  Sj(t+1)
           S0(t)                                     Qj                                 yk




                                                                     …




                                                                                    …
           Sj(t)
                                  Sm(t+1)
           Sm(t)                                     Qm                                 yN

                                                     РЧС
               ……




                      Ксх3                  y1
                                    …


                                            yk
      x1
                                    …
             …




      xL                                    yN



                   Рис. 5.8. Структурная схема одноуровневой системы МПУ,
                       представленная на основе использования НД СКУ
                                в виде совмещенного C-автомата

На рис. 5.8 представлены следующие блоки системы МПУ:
Ксх1 - многовыходная комбинационная схема реализует функции переходов
в системе МПУ (последовательность выполнения микрокоманд):
  Y
S j j (t  1)  f j ( x1 , x2 ,..., x L , S 0 , S1 ,..., S m ),     j  0, m                 (5.12)
Ксх2 - многовыходная комбинационная схема реализует функции выходов
модели автомата Мура:
                             y k (t )  VS j j (t ),
                                                 Y
                                                           k  1, N ;
                                                                                             (5.13)
                                      (S j )(Y j  y k )
Ксх3 - многовыходная комбинационная схема реализует функции выходов
модели автомата Мили:
                             y k (t )  VS j j (t  1),
                                                 Y
                                                                  k  1, N                   (5.14)
где [x1, x2,…, xL] - элементарные входные сигналы (осведомительные сигналы
от операционного автомата (ОА) );
[y1,…, yk,…, yN] - элементарные выходные сигналы, инициирующие
выполнение микроопераций в ОА;
[S0, S1,…, Sm] - частные события, реализуемые в алгоритме управления;
Yj - совокупность управляющих сигналов, отмечающих событие Sj ;
РЧС - регистр частных событий, организованный на двухступенчатых Д-
триггерах; для унитарного кодирования событий каждому событию Sj

                                                                                                      136